The Nursing Midwifery Council (NMC) register has reached its highest level with 732,000 members, thanks to increased retention and international recruitment, particularly from the Philippines and India. The emotional toll on healthcare workers, especially in intensive care, is significant, highlighting the need for mental health support. Poor workplace culture and pressure are key reasons for staff leaving, emphasizing the importance of creating supportive environments. Improving work conditions, flexibility, and professional development opportunities are crucial for retaining healthcare staff.
